HISAR, OCT 15: In an unusual incident, a teacher allegedly pulled the right ear of a Std II student so hard that it was ripped out. The incident, reported from the Sewa Bharti Charitable Trust School, left 10-year-old Sudhir bleeding profusely. He later fainted and was admitted to a local private nursing home.According to information available, two students had a quarrel over sharing of seats in the class, and when the teacher, Vandana came to know of it, she pulled Sudhir's ear so hard that part of the ear lobe came off.
Fellow students informed the parents of the boy, who took him to a local hospital. Sudhir was then taken to another private hospital where a skin specialist operated on the boy.
An official of the school, Rajender Goel, when contacted, confirmed the incident but said it happened as the child already had some problem with his ear, and the teacher was not at fault. ``She just pulled the right ear gently when it got separated,'' he claimed, adding that the management had decided to bearall expenses of the treatment. Asked about any action against the teacher, he said, ``There is no question of any action as the teacher is a gentle lady and was not at fault.''
However, Sudhir's parents denied that their son had any problem in the ear.
